How about a philosophical view of unity of opposites
It is the view of contradiction. The relationship between things that exist in both opposition and unity is contradiction. Contradiction is the category of relationship.
The two conflicting sides have both struggle and unity. Struggle is absolute and unity is conditional.
Contradictory identity, that is, unity, interdependence, mutual conditions, I have you, you have me, such as "you" and "I" is unity, without the concept of "you" does not matter the concept of "I", there is no "long", there is no "short", that is to say, the two are "unity".
Contradictory struggle, that is, opposites, separate from each other, mutually exclusive, under certain conditions, transformation. Such as "long" and "short" is the opposite concept they are mutually exclusive, is a pair of contradictions, but if the "short" things added to the long enough, "short" becomes long, that is, a certain condition of transformation.
